Jean Dennis Bliss passed away peacefully on Thursday, February 12, 2026, at the age of 102.
Born on February 6, 1924, in Grundy, Virginia, Jean was the beloved daughter of the late John Waldron Dennis and Marion McMaster Marshal Dennis. She spent her childhood on Wildwood Road in a home hand-built by her father, an artistic and innovative man whose creativity left a lasting impression on her life. Jean cherished her summers on Chincoteague Island along the Northern Shores of Virginia, where her mother grew up - memories she carried with her always.
Jean attended Andrew Lewis High School, where she met the love of her life, the late Verne F. Bliss. She later received her teaching degree from Radford College. The young couple briefly moved to North Carolina, where Jean taught school while Verne attended Duke University. They began building their life together and growing their family before returning to Virginia to raise their four children.
Shortly after the birth of their twins, Jean and Verne embarked on a grand adventure, moving their young family to Uruguay, South America, where they lived for six years. In 1961, they settled in Atlanta, Georgia, building a home where they would live for the next 56 years.
Jean lived a vibrant, full life defined by love, hospitality, and joy. She and Verne shared a passion for travel, camping, fishing, and country living. Together, after Verne's retirement, they spent time in Virginia where they started a strawberry and Christmas tree farm. They created a home that was a gathering place for friends from around the world. Jean had a wonderful sense of fashion and delighted in hosting themed parties, making every guest feel welcome and celebrated.
She was arguably the best golfer in the family - challenged only by her husband - and was a proud Masters Patron since 1963. Jean was also a dedicated supporter of the Women's Health Initiative for over 30 years.
Above all, Jean expressed her love through care and kindness. She always made time for her friends and family, often sharing that love in the form of something homemade from her kitchen. Her warmth, strength, and generous spirit touched everyone who knew her.
Jean is survived by her four children, Marsha Hornick, Verne Bliss, Dennis Bliss, and Annita Korb; 7 grandchildren; and 14 great-grandchildren. Her legacy of love, faith, adventure, and family will live on through each of them.
Jean Bliss will be remembered for her elegance, her competitive spirit, her hospitality, and the deep and steady love she gave so freely. She leaves behind a family rooted in her strength and a community made brighter by her presence.
